Located South West of Barton Town, the Bright Valley Petting Zoo is filled with an assortment of animals from all over Gaia. Open to visitors from 11 AM to 7 PM Monday through Saturday with occasional special hours in times of high profile animal births, Bright Valley's 20 acres are a constantly shifting landscape of wildlife and farmland.

Founded 200 years ago when the last head of the Cesrum family willed his family's land to the Temple of Falis in Barton Town, Bright Valley's secondary purpose is to supply produce to Barton's Temple to be consumed by it's inhabitants and the hundreds that depend on the church's soup kitchens for meals.

Bright Valley's buildings consist of a central Farm House in which the current head of the conservatory, Father Pirsan Cothmith, resides along with any other employees. Several rooms have been set aside within the large house for travelers heading north to Barton or Durem from Barton Trench or any other corner of Gaia.

The entire compound is fenced with a single entrance gate for visitors and deliveries. The gravel entrance road leads directly to the Farm House and encircles it and from this primary road branches all other paths to the different sections of the petting zoo.

Signs line the entrance road directing visitors to the Farm House for admission into the zoo, the rules of the establishment clearly marked on several of them in various languages. The zoo itself is situated between the entrance and the Farm House, though access within the pens is only allowed through specific gates which employees will open for patrons that have registered at the Farm House. Behind the Farm House are the restricted access pens and the farmlands, whose acreage is only accessible by Bright Valley employees or members of the Temple of Falis's Council of Elders.

For security purposes, the entire premises is under video & magical surveillance.

    • Armadillo Cows
      Bright Valley's most famous animals, the Armadillo Cows that inhabit the zoo have been bred to be nigh impervious to all attack and have an extremely nutritious milk, extra rich in calcium. Curling up into balls when threatened, the Armadillo Cow's hide is rumored to be able to withstand nuclear blasts.

      In the petting zoo, we have a number of baby Armadillo Cows for young Gaians to pet and several adult cows on display with handlers available to teach children how to milk them.



    • Pipe Foxes
      A pair of Pipe Foxes were given to Bright Valley by a caravan in thanks for providing a single nights room and board and the colony that exists now are all descendants of the original pair. Affectionate and fun, the Pipe Foxes are kept in a large atrium so that they don't fly away and always swarm patrons that enter it inquisitively, sniffing and inspecting them to satisfy their curiosity.

      Very magical beings and deemed as bringers of good luck, the Pipe Foxes of Bright Valley are a great first animal to bring any shy youngsters to pet.



    • Gelatinous Cubes
      True to their name, Bright Valley's Gelatinous Cubes are squares of sentient jelly. They come in an assortment of colors and when angry, can grow up to two times their size and can engulf a full grown man. The jelly cubes available for petting are all adolescents and too small even when angry to engulf a man and would only rise to one's knee. The animals available to the public are the most temperate ones that often attempt to squelch around the legs of the patrons petting them in affection, not attack.

      Their secretions are a variety of fruity flavors depending on their color.



    • Ducks
      The petting zoo houses all manner of Ducks, with a range of ducklings available for petting while supervised by a Bright Valley employee.



    • Landsharks
      Remaining burrowed under the ground the majority of the day our colony of Landsharks are one of the tame breeds of the species, domesticated across Gaia for tilling the soil and searching for buried treasure. Their skin is rock hard and white, specifically on their faces, which allows them to easily 'swim' through the ground with each powerful thrust of their tail.

      Bright Valley's Landsharks love to be petted and reside in a shaded den so that their sun sensitive skin is not exposed overlong.
